Summary

House Bill 3068, known as the West Virginia STEM Scholarship Act, aims to address the critical shortage of qualified STEM educators in West Virginia. The bill provides financial incentives in the form of scholarships for certified teachers specializing in science, technology, engineering, or mathematics who meet specific criteria. This initiative seeks to retain and attract qualified professionals in these essential fields by offering significant debt relief for educators who commit to teaching in West Virginia schools for extended periods. The scholarship amounts are tiered, rewarding teachers based on their years of service, with the potential for up to $10,000 in debt relief for those employed for a decade or more in a STEM position.

Sentiment

The general sentiment surrounding HB 3068 is largely supportive, with various educational stakeholders acknowledging the necessity of building a stronger STEM workforce. Advocates perceive the bill as a crucial step towards enhancing educational quality and supporting dedicated teachers. However, there may be some concerns regarding the sustainability and funding of the scholarship program, particularly in light of its sunset provision, which stipulates that the program will last for only six years before reevaluating its effectiveness and funding needs. This has led to discussions about long-term investment in education versus short-term measures.
